Peer-to-Peer Distributed Chat Application with Fault Tolerance

Regent Digitech Private LimitedPeer-To-Peer Networking Industry
LocationRemote
#HiringActivily
#TopOpportunity

Project Objectives:

Create a decentralized peer-to-peer chat system enabling users to communicate without centralized servers while ensuring message delivery, node discovery, and fault tolerance.

Project Tasks:

Study P2P network architectures.

Design decentralized communication model.

Implement peer discovery mechanism.

Develop message broadcasting protocol.

Add encryption for secure communication.

Implement message acknowledgment system.

Handle peer disconnection gracefully.

Simulate network partition scenarios.

Measure network latency.

Optimize message routing.

Deploy across multiple virtual machines.

Implement logging and monitoring.

Document architecture design.

Conduct reliability testing.
